1. What are 213 series CA/CC spherical roller bearings?
213 series CA/CC spherical roller bearings are self-aligning bearings designed to withstand heavy radial loads and moderate axial loads. These bearings consist of an inner ring with two raceways, an outer ring, a set of spherical rollers, and a cage. The CA/CC suffix denotes the type of cage used in the bearing.
2. Construction of 213 series CA/CC spherical roller bearings:
The inner ring of the bearing is designed to accommodate the shaft, while the outer ring provides support and holds the bearing in place. Between the inner and outer rings, the spherical rollers allow for self-alignment and distribute the load evenly. The cage, made of steel or brass, separates and guides the rollers, ensuring smooth rotation.
3. Key features and benefits:
- High load-carrying capacity: 213 series CA/CC spherical roller bearings can handle heavy radial loads and moderate axial loads, making them suitable for demanding industrial applications.
- Self-aligning capability: The spherical design allows for misalignment compensation, preventing excessive stress and premature failure.
- Enhanced durability: These bearings are designed to withstand harsh operating conditions, including high temperatures, shock, and vibration.
- Versatile applications: 213 series CA/CC spherical roller bearings find use in various industries such as mining, construction, steel, and more.

Post code for self-aligning roller bearings

Install the tapered hole self-aligning roller bearings with the rear codes K and K30 on the matching locking sleeve to become the K+H and K30+H type bearings with the rear codes. This type of bearing can be installed on an optical shaft without a shoulder, and is suitable for occasions where frequent installation and disassembly of bearings are required. In order to improve the lubrication performance of the bearing, there is an annular oil groove on the outer ring of the bearing and three evenly distributed oil holes are drilled, with the post code W33.

The use of self-aligning roller bearings

Main applicable cages: stamped steel plate reinforced cages (suffix E, rarely found in China). Stamped steel plate type cage (suffix CC), glass fiber reinforced polyamide 66 cage (suffix TVPB), and machined brass two-piece cage (suffix MB). Machined brass integral cages (suffix CA), stamped steel plate cages for vibration applications (suffix JPA). Brass cage for vibration situations (suffix EMA).

Installation of four row tapered roller bearings

The fit between the inner ring of the four row tapered roller bearing and the roller neck is generally with clearance. When installing, first install the bearing into the bearing box, and then install the bearing box into the journal.

What are the characteristics of Deep Groove Ball Bearing?

After the Deep Groove Ball Bearing is installed on the shaft, the axial displacement in both directions of the shaft or housing can be limited within the axial clearance range of the bearing, so the axial positioning can be made in both directions. In addition, this type of bearing also has a certain degree of centering ability. When tilted 2 'to 10' relative to the casing hole, it can still work normally, but it has a certain impact on the bearing life.
